The technology built by WealthOS, a London/Colombo-based cloud-native wealth tech SaaS, has powered the migration of 126,000 UK ISA and Junior ISA accounts from Embark (FNZ) to Quai Digital, its flagship UK client and a London-based white-label digital savings and investment platform services provider.

The migration was conducted on behalf of The Children’s ISA (TCI), the UK’s specialist provider of children’s ISA (tax-free savings) products, and is one of the largest completed migrations out of FNZ to date.

The migration of 126,000 accounts was completed just seven months after Quai Digital won instruction from TCI. TCI had depended on FNZ and its platform partner Embark for platform management services for the last nine years.

Following engagement with Embark (FNZ), the migration programme itself took just five months.


This included the physical migration of investor account data and the bulk transfer of cash and assets, completed in just four weeks.

The successful completion of this migration to Quai Digital’s operating platform, which was powered by WealthOS technology built in Sri Lanka, enabled an all-in-one transition process—a clear break from the industry’s more standard phased approach.

About WealthOS

WealthOS is a London-headquartered cloud-native middle - and back-office SaaS platform serving global wealth management firms, banks, platform providers, brokers, and other financial institutions.


Its migrations for firms to date are proving the company’s ability to handle business volumes for many of the Tier 2+ firms that make up more than 50% of the UK wealth management market.

WealthOS’ distinctive modular operating system paves the way for 3x faster product development and 40% less cost.


It makes light work of the most complex migrations and empowers UK wealth management firms to scale and expand their operations using market-leading technology.


Founded in 2019 and with operations in the UK and Sri Lanka,
WealthOS is backed by Barclays and Main Set, part of international investment firm Capricorn Capital Partners UK.
